At Lauren’s Institute for Education (L.I.F.E.), we provide a variety of therapies that nurture the overall growth of developmentally disabled children to improve their quality of life and the lives of their family members. Our philosophy of care addresses the whole child, from emotional well-being to cognitive and physical functioning, and our staff recognize and celebrate the unique characteristics of each child. We also provide disability accommodations in accordance with the Americans with Disabilities Act. Co-Founder and President Carrie Reed established L.I.F.E. out of love for her daughter Lauren, who was diagnosed with Sanfilippo Syndrome in 2004.
